#488f2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#488f2f is composed of 28.2% red, 56.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 104.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 37.3%. #488f2f color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ff5e with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#488f2f color description : Dark moderate green.
#488f2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#488f2f has RGB values of R:72, G:143,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4755247.

Shades and Tints of #488f2f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#488f2f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d635b is the less saturated color, while #33bb03 is the most saturated one.
